Abstract :
The aim of this paper is to investigate some numerical issues involved in the Moment Method solution of the radiated field by axially symmetric antennas (Body of Revolution antennas) that are very large in terms of the wavelength. The approaches found in the literature are reviewed and an improvement is introduced for decreasing the computational cost when the integrands are singular and oscillatory.
